#DBDE71 Hex Color Code

#DBDE71

The Hexadecimal Color #DBDE71 is a contrast shade of Khaki. #DBDE71 RGB value is rgb(219, 222, 113). RGB Color Model of #DBDE71 consists of 85% red, 87% green and 44% blue. HSL color Mode of #DBDE71 has 62°(degrees) Hue, 62% Saturation and 66% Lightness. #DBDE71 color has an wavelength of 580.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DBDE71 is #FFFF99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DBDE71 is #DD7. The Closest Color to #DBDE71 is #F0E68C. Official Name of #DBDE71 Hex Code is Chenin.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DBDE71 is 1 Cyan 0 Magenta 49 Yellow 13 Black and #DBDE71 CMY is 1, 0, 49.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DBDE71 is hsl(62,62,66,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(62, 49, 87).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DBDE71 is 58.32, 68.5, 25.77.
Hex8 Value of #DBDE71 is #DBDE71FF. Decimal Value of #DBDE71 is 14409329 and Octal Value of #DBDE71 is 66757161. Binary Value of #DBDE71 is 11011011, 11011110, 1110001 and Android of #DBDE71 is 4292599409 / 0xffdbde71.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DBDE71 is 0.382, 0.449, 0.449 and YIQ Color Space of #DBDE71 is 208.677, 33.234, -34.5553.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DBDE71 is 67.98, 75.4, 26.45.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DBDE71 is 86.26, -15.88, 52.59.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DBDE71 is 86.26, 3.05, 69.17.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DBDE71 is 86.26, 54.94, 106.8. Hunter Lab variable of #DBDE71 is 82.76, -19.06, 39.47.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DBDE71

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
